Job description

Cloud Architect with AI experience

Location: Trenton, NJ

Position Type: Contract

In Person interview Only
  • Cloud Architect who possesses both advanced cloud engineering skills and hands-on experience supporting, configuring, and optimizing AI models and tools.
  • A Cloud Architect with AI experience will provide the following value:
  • Design and optimization of AI-ready cloud environments: Modern AI workloads require specialized architectures, including high performance compute, GPU clusters, container orchestration, and distributed storage. An experienced architect ensures these environments are properly designed, cost efficient, and aligned with best practices.
  • Integration of AI tools into existing systems: As AI tools become embedded across business processes, we need expertise in securely connecting models, APIs, vector databases, and pipelines to our existing applications and data sources.
  • Support for model deployment and lifecycle management: Effective use of AI requires more than just model development. We need an expert who can manage deployment, monitoring, versioning, and scaling to ensure models operate reliably and safely in production environments.
  • Governance, security, and compliance: AI systems introduce new risks related to data handling, model outputs, and access control. A Cloud Architect with AI expertise can implement guardrails, enforce cloud security policies, and ensure alignment with organizational, legal, and ethical standards.
  • Cost management and operational efficiency: AI workloads can incur significant compute and storage costs if not properly architected. An experienced professional can implement automation, workload right sizing, and optimization strategies to reduce expenses.
  • Support for innovation initiatives: As AI tools continue to evolve, this role will allow the organization to pilot new technologies, evaluate vendor solutions, and rapidly implement new capabilities without compromising security or stability.
